Center for Visual & Decision Informatics
Established in 2012, the Center for Visual and Decision Informatics is a National Science Foundation Industry-University Cooperative Research Center that works in partnership with government, industry, and academia to develop the next-generation visual and decision support tools and techniques that enable decision-makers to significantly improve the way their organization’s information is organized and interpreted.
University partners include the University of Louisiana at Lafayette, Drexel University, Tampere University, Stony Brook University, University of Virginia, and University of North Carolina at Charlotte.
